GoCardless is an open banking API aggregator headquartered in GB. It provides account information (AIS), payment initiation (PIS), account or identity verification through a single integration, so apps can reach many banks with the customer's consent instead of building one connection per bank.
Open Banking Tracker lists 2,228 institutions reachable through GoCardless. Real coverage can differ by product, market, and individual bank, so use the supported-banks table on this page and confirm specific institutions in GoCardless's own documentation.
Yes. GoCardless Ltd FCA-authorised under PSR 2017 (UK, reg. 597190). Authorisations held: FCA. Verify current licensing on the relevant regulator's public register before you rely on it.
Yes. GoCardless offers payment initiation (PIS), so you can move money account-to-account ("pay by bank") with the payer's authorisation. Product names and market availability vary — confirm in GoCardless's documentation.
Yes. GoCardless offers verification products (such as account-ownership or income checks) built on its open banking connectivity. PIS = Instant Bank Pay; AIS = Bank Account Data API (ex-Nordigen); verification = Verified Mandates. EU AIS via the Nordigen-derived API; only UK FCA authorisation named on its own legal page.
